The Benzoic acid,4-formyl-3-nitro-, methyl ester, with the CAS registry number 153813-69-5, is also known as 4-Formyl-3-nitrobenzoicacid methyl ester. It belongs to the product categories of Aldehydes; C9; Carbonyl Compounds. This chemical's molecular formula is C9H7NO5 and molecular weight is 209.16. What's more, its systematic name is methyl 4-formyl-3-nitrobenzoate. It is stable at common pressure and temperature, and it should be sealed and stored in a cool and dry place. What's more, it should be protected from strong oxidants.
Physical properties of Benzoic acid,4-formyl-3-nitro-, methyl ester are: (1)ACD/LogP: 2.04; (2)# of Rule of 5 Violations: 0; (3)#H bond acceptors: 6; (4)#H bond donors: 0; (5)#Freely Rotating Bonds: 4; (6)Polar Surface Area: 89.19 Å2; (7)Index of Refraction: 1.596; (8)Molar Refractivity: 51.32 cm3; (9)Molar Volume: 150.8 cm3; (10)Polarizability: 20.34×10-24cm3; (11)Surface Tension: 56 dyne/cm; (12)Density: 1.386 g/cm3; (13)Flash Point: 190.2 °C; (14)Enthalpy of Vaporization: 62.81 kJ/mol; (15)Boiling Point: 380 °C at 760 mmHg; (16)Vapour Pressure: 5.61E-06 mmHg at 25°C.
